Max Payne 3 The Dynamic Library Gsrlddll Failed To Load Better

To defeat an enemy, you must first understand it. The file gsrld.dll is not an official Rockstar Games file. It is a cracked dynamic link library created by a warez group known as "GSR" (often associated with R.G. Mechanics or similar scene groups).

In simpler terms:

The core irony: Most people seeing this error think they have a legitimate copy. In reality, they either installed a cracked version years ago, used a No-CD patch, or downloaded a repack that left this file behind. To defeat an enemy, you must first understand it


Players launching Max Payne 3 on PC may encounter a fatal error message stating:

"The dynamic library 'gsrld.dll' failed to load. Please confirm you have a valid copy of the game and try again." The core irony: Most people seeing this error

This error prevents the game from starting and is notoriously common in older Rockstar titles. It is almost exclusively related to SecuROM, the digital rights management (DRM) software used by the game, or conflicts with system security software.

A quick Google search throws up dozens of “DLL fixer” tools. Do not run them. They often contain: Players launching Max Payne 3 on PC may

The only safe DLL source is a clean rip from a scene group’s release or a direct copy from a working install.